AI Benefiting Different Businesses

Amazon was one of the first companies to have integrated AI into their digital domain. They designed a personalised recommendation system by using artificial intelligence.

This greatly improved the user experience. Their online customers started getting relevant recommendations based on their previous shopping preferences.

Similarly, AI has proved its importance for non-profit digital marketing as well. There are many ways non-profit online marketing campaigns can succeed with the help of AI.

For example, the AI-backed predictive analysis can help NGOs in:

  • Getting more positive responses to direct mails and emails
  • Boosting regular donation programs
  • Targeting donors with the right propensity 

By making AI an integral part of their non-profit digital marketing strategy, GreenPeace AU, Parkinson’s UK, and other NGOs have been able to:

  • Improve segmentation techniques to target potential donors.
  • Send the right message across to relevant segments.
  • Target more donors who are likely to respond to their fundraising campaigns.

Chatbots

One of the best examples of AI in digital marketing is chatbots. Chatbots are computer programs. They use conversational AI to simulate conversation with a human user. It can be done via messenger applications, website chat boxes, and telephones.

Chatbots reduce the reliance on service agents with incredible cost-efficiency. Using rule-based language applications, they can engage customers. This, in turn, elevates the online shopping experience to a whole new level.

For example:

  • Quick Query Resolution: Chatbots can drive conversations with customers via live chat functions. Now, customers don’t have to wait for a service agent. They can get all their answers in real-time. 
  • Data Collection: Chatbots can collect more data from the users. In turn, they provide them with more relevant information.

It’s relatively common and a lot of brands have now used chatbots to up their marketing game. For instance, Sephora has launched a chatbot on its website that gives beauty tips.

Content Generation

Can artificial intelligence produce content? Well, with some exceptions, it can!

News portals like Forbes, CNN, and AP are already using applications. For example, Wordsmith and Quill can generate content that increases their visitors.

Of course, AI can’t possibly come up with opinionated articles and columns. However, AI software can create reports and analyses. It can research tons of data to create informative content.

It can be time-saving and generate a lot of clicks on your website, driving way more traffic than before. But still, it’s too early to put all your eggs in the AI basket. It still lacks the element of creativity and human-friendliness of a professional copywriter.

Instead, hiring a professional content marketing service would be better. A professional service knows: 

  • When to leverage AI tools, and 
  • What tools can help you come up with the best content 

For example, tools like Grammarly, Hemingway Editor, and others can reduce content-generation time. These AI-supported tools can help you edit and improve an article written by a human.
